See allWelcome to the Post-Apocalypse
You Are a Survivor
VEIN is a post-apocalyptic survival multiplayer sandbox game. Gather supplies to survive, explore abandoned buildings, defend your home, and rebuild society, whether alone or with friends. Set in upstate New York after a devastating collapse, VEIN challenges you to survive in a harsh, dynamic environment.
Survive Together or Alone
Experience the world of VEIN with friends, with enemies, alone, or a combination of all three. Build safehouses, establish defenses against raiders, hunt and fish for food, and experience long-term survivalism. When canned goods run out, you're on your own.
Dynamic World and Intelligent AI
As time passes and seasons change, the world of VEIN does too. Persistent, large-scale random events affect gameplay. AI can see, hear, feel, and smell you--terrifying zombie variants make survival that much more difficult. Open mailboxes, adjust faucets, knock on doors, and interact with a fully simulated world featuring electrical, plumbing, and natural gas systems.

Without indifferent broccoli
Running a VEIN dedicated server is... complicated.
System Requirements
To run a VEIN dedicated server, you'll want a system with at least 12GB of RAM and a quad-core processor. You will also need a minimum 20GB of free storage. The operating system should be Linux (Ubuntu 20.04+) or Windows 10/11 (64-bit), Windows Server 2019-2022. Modded servers will require even more processing power.
Installation
You can install the server using SteamCMD.
For Linux:
steamcmd +force_install_dir ./vein_server/ +login anonymous +app_update 2131400 +quit
For Windows:
steamcmd.exe +force_install_dir c:\SteamCMD\vein_server\ +login anonymous +app_update 2131400 +quit
You'll need to forward the default game port (7777) and query port (27015).
Starting the server
You can launch the dedicated server from the command line in the server's directory:
Linux:
./VeinServer.sh -log -Port=7777 -QueryPort=27015
Windows:
VeinServer.exe -log -Port=7777 -QueryPort=27015
